Orchard View is a comprehensive rehabilitation and skilled nursing facility located in Columbus, Georgia, situated at the intersection of Williams and Whitesville Road near Interstate 185-N. The community spans 26,000 square feet and features beautifully landscaped grounds with fruit-bearing trees and plants, courtyards, and views of white oaks surrounding the property.
The facility provides skilled nursing care and rehabilitation services including Physical, Occupational, Speech/Language Pathology, and Respiratory Therapy, overseen by a Rehabilitation Medical Director. The 32-bed Rehab unit treats orthopedic, neurological, amputation, and medical decline conditions to help residents transition back to their customary routines. A dedicated memory care unit serves individuals with memory impairment and behavioral issues, using specialized approaches to preserve remaining abilities and featuring personalized "memory boxes" outside each room where families can place meaningful items.
Residents receive assistance with activities of daily living such as bathing, dressing, grooming, and incontinence care, with a full professional nursing staff available 24 hours a day. The facility maintains multiple dining areas where residents choose from multiple entree options at each meal, with the culinary staff focusing on meeting individual nutritional needs. Comfortable residential-style accommodations feature modern décor and access to multiple leisure areas.
Activities programming includes themed socials, live entertainment, educational programs, board games, electronic Wii, pet therapy, and music therapy. Social services staff work closely with residents and families to develop individualized plans of care, with each neighborhood assigned its own social worker to support psychosocial well-being and facilitate the transition from home or hospital settings.
